How to Make It in America is an American comedy-drama television series created by Ian Edelman that follows the adventures of two enterprising twenty-somethings hustling their way through New York City's fashion scene, determined to achieve their version of the American Dream.

The series aired in the USA on HBO from 14 February, 2010 to 20 November, 2011. There are 16 half-hour episodes in two seasons.

How to Make It in America premiered in South Africa on DStv's Vuzu channel on Tuesday 28 September 2010, at 21h00. See "Seasons" below for seasonal broadcast dates and times.

Season 1 aired on Vuzu from 28 September to 16 November, 2010, on Tuesdays at 21h00. New episodes broadcast weekly. There are eight episodes in the first season.

How to Make It in America follows two enterprising Brooklyn twenty-somethings as they hustle their way through New York City, determined to achieve the American Dream.

Trying to make a name for themselves in New York's competitive fashion scene, Ben Epstein (Bryan Greenberg) and his friend and business partner Cam Calderon (Victor Rasuk) use their street knowledge and connections to bring their ambitions to fruition.

With the help of Cam's cousin Rene (Luis Guzman), who is trying to market his own high-energy drink called Rasta Monsta, and their well-connected friend Domingo (Kid Cudi), the entrepreneurs set out to make it big, encountering obstacles along the way that will require all their ingenuity to overcome.

How to Make It in America also stars Lake Bell as Ben's ex-girlfriend Rachel, who is concentrating on her own career and a new relationship; Martha Plimpton as Rachel's boss Edie, an eccentric interior designer; Shannyn Sossamon as Gingy, Ben and Cam's artsy friend; and Eddie Kaye Thomas as David Kaplan, a successful hedge fund manager and high school friend of Ben's.

Creator and first-time writer Ian Edelman collaborated with Emmy nominee Rob Weiss (Entourage) on many of the show's scripts. The pilot and other episodes of the show were directed by Julian Farino.

How to Make It in America is produced by HBO Entertainment with executive producers Stephen Levinson, Rob Weiss, Ian Edelman, Julian Farino, Jada Miranda and Mark Wahlberg; and producer Jane Raab.
